At least 50 worshippers in Nigeria killed by gunmen

– – Gunmen on Sunday stormed a catholic church in Nigeria’s Ondo state killing at least 50 people and injuring several others. Local media reported that the attack on the worshippers took place during a mass service. They had fired at worshippers and detonated explosives at the church. Africa records 1,400 cases of monkeypox

– – Seven African countries have cumulatively reported about 1,400 monkeypox cases. The World Health Organization (WHO) said the cases were all recorded by mid-May. They include 1,392 suspected and 44 confirmed cases.
